Enterprises are moving away from "throwaway" kitchenware. The current trend is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) optimization. A board that lasts 24 months in a high-volume hotel kitchen is vastly superior to a cheaper alternative that needs replacement every 6 months. Top China factories are now providing documented wear-test data to back these claims.

What defines a "Hotel Grade" kitchen board vs. a consumer board? +
Hotel-grade boards are engineered for 18+ hours of daily use. They feature higher density (specific gravity > 0.96), heat resistance up to 120°C for commercial dishwashers, and non-porous surfaces that prevent cross-contamination in accordance with NSF/ANSI standards.
How do China factories ensure HACCP compliance? +
Compliance is managed through color-coding (Red for raw meat, Blue for seafood, etc.) and by using FDA-approved raw materials. Factories undergo third-party audits (SGS, Intertek) to verify that no heavy metals or toxic plasticizers are present in the final product.
Can these factories handle bespoke dimensions for custom kitchen islands? +
Yes, most top factories utilize CNC routing technology allowing for "Just-In-Time" custom sizing. This is vital for integrated commercial kitchen systems where boards must fit perfectly into prep-table recesses.
